From Raw Story, Nov. 29, by Carl Gibson:
Trump wrote in a Friday post to his Truth Social platform that he was endorsing Nasry "Tito" Asfura in Sunday's presidential election in Honduras, and that his administration would be "very supportive" of Asfura's government if he won. …
Trump's announcement caught many off-guard, with various journalists, commentators and experts denouncing the president for freeing a convicted drug trafficker – especially as the Trump administration continues to carry out fatal and potentially illegal strikes on boats it alleges are trafficking drugs to the United States. …
Trump did not immediately state his reason for pardoning Hernández. However, the former Honduran leader is connected to multiple wealthy Trump supporters, including Silicon Valley billionaire Peter Thiel. The New York Times reported in 2024 that Thiel (who bankrolled Vice President JD Vance's 2022 U.S. Senate campaign), along with OpenAI CEO Sam Altman and venture capitalist Marc Andreesen, worked with Hernández when he was president of Honduras' congress to launch a "start-up city" called Próspera.
"Próspera is a private, for-profit city, with its own government that courts foreign investors through low taxes and light regulation," the Times' Rachel Corbett wrote. "Businesses can choose a regulatory framework from a menu of 36 countries or customize their own."
